**Q: What changed in the Pellwick password-reset revamp, and how do reviewers test it?**

A: Short version — we ditched emailed reset links for one-time codes scoped to a single device, with a five-minute expiry. Rate limits are per-account and per-source now, so the old enumeration trick won't fly. For review, use the Stagglebrook sandbox tenant; everything's instrumented there. To open the sandbox's sealed credentials bundle, enter the recovery passphrase that appears directly below.

strongbox words: aldax-istox-sorion-isteth-gilion-tamius-norok-aldax-fraox-wenius

Hi dispatch desk,

For the warehouse shift lead: a consignment of sealed exam papers for the Westmoor Qualifications Board arrives Thursday between 09:00 and 10:00 via Redgate Express. Please keep bay 4 clear, verify every seal against the manifest before accepting, and move the boxes straight to the secure cage — no staging on the open floor. Two staff must be present for the acceptance, and nothing gets signed until both seals and counts match. The courier hand-over itself must follow the confidential instruction below.

handover note for yagef-bagep: the drudor pelius courier leaves the kasdor zorvan norir ledger at gate 8016 under passcode 755406

## Webhook retries, the short version

Welcome to the Hookline team! When Relayette fails to deliver a webhook, we retry with exponential backoff: 1m, 5m, 30m, 2h, then every 6h for up to three days. A 410 from the receiver cancels retries immediately; everything else (timeouts, 5xx) keeps the schedule going. Duplicate deliveries are possible, so consumers must be idempotent — we stamp each attempt with the same event token. To poke the retry queue yourself in the sandbox, use the shared diagnostics credential below:

app token of tadug-yahag = vxb3-949